Econoline E250 3/4 Ton V8-4.6L SOHC VIN W (2000)
Mass Air Flow Sensor: Service and Repair
REMOVAL
1. Disconnect the battery ground cable. For additional information, refer to Battery.
2. Remove the air cleaner assembly. For additional information, refer to Fuel Delivery and Air Induction.
3. Open the air cleaner.
^
Release the air cleaner clamp.
^
Separate the inlet side from the outlet side of the air cleaner.
CAUTION: Do not tamper with the Mass Air Flow (MAF) sensing elements located in the airflow meter. Tampering may result in unit failure.
NOTE: The MAF sensor and body are calibrated and serviced as a unit.
4. Remove the MAF assembly.
5. Disconnect the MAF sensor electrical connector.
